    • Vulnerability & Exposure Management
      • Lead vulnerability management activities across client environments, including vulnerability identification, prioritization, remediation tracking, and validation.
      • Guide the team in determining which vulnerabilities present the greatest real-world risk based on severity, exploitability, asset criticality, exposure, and business impact.
      • Help clients move beyond simply identifying vulnerabilities by supporting the remediation process through closure.
      • Track critical and aging vulnerabilities and ensure appropriate escalation and remediation plans are in place.
      • Support Attack Surface Management and Exposure Management initiatives across client environments.
      • Work closely with client infrastructure, cloud, security, application, and operations teams to drive vulnerability remediation.
      • Ensure vulnerabilities are retested and validated following remediation.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
